The ICC today announced details of the umpire and match referee appointments for upcoming ODI series in Ireland, the Netherlands and Zimbabwe as well as the Test and ODI series between England and India.
Ireland, West Indies, Scotland and the Netherlands will play in a series of ODIs in Dublin and Belfast from 10 to 15 July. Ranjan Madugalle and Chris Board from the Emirates Elite Panel of ICC Match Referees have been appointed as match referees at the two venues.
Madugalle will oversee matches in Dublin with Nigel Llong and Amiesh Saheba of the Emirates International Panel of ICC Umpires appointed to stand. Broad will be in charge of the Belfast matches will be umpired by Darrell Hair of the Emirates Elite Panel of ICC Umpires and Shahul Hameed of the ICC Associates and Affiliates Umpires International Panel.
The action will then switch to Lord's where England will take on India in the three-Test, seven-ODI series from 19 July to 8 September.
Madugalle will be the match referee for the Test series while Roshan Mahanama of the Emirates Elite Panel of ICC Match Referees will be the match referee for the ODI series.
The first Test will be played from 19-23 July with Simon Taufel and Steve Bucknor of the Emirates Elite Panel of ICC Umpires taking charge.
The second Test will take place at Trent Bridge from 27-31 July and will be umpired by Taufel and Ian Howell of Emirates Elite Panel of ICC Umpires.
Bucknor and Howell have been selected to stand in the third Test, which will be played at The Oval from 9-13 August.
Before taking on England in ODIs, India will travel to Glasgow for an ODI against Scotland to be played on 16 August. Madugalle will be the match referee while Howell and Ian Gould of the Emirates International Panel of ICC Umpires will be the umpires.
Billy Doctrove of the Emirates Elite Panel of ICC Umpires will supervise the first three ODIs between England and India on 21, 24 and, 27 August while Aleem Dar, also of Emirates Elite Panel, will stand in the last four matches to be played on 30 August, 2, 5 and 8 September.
Broad has been named as match referee for the two ODIs between the Netherlands and Bermuda to be played in Amsterdam on 18 and 20 August. Umpires for the series will be appointed in due course.
For the three-match ODI series between Zimbabwe and South Africa, Javagal Srinath has been named as match referee while Steve Davis has been appointed as umpire.
The series opener has been scheduled for Bulawayo on 22 August while the last two matches are due to be played in Harare on 25 and 26 August.
